Hollywood stars showed off glamorous looks on the red carpet before the 32nd Actor Awards, formerly known as the Screen Actors Guild Awards.
The awards ceremony, which rewarded the best performances of 2025, was held on Sunday night at the Shrine Auditorium and Expo Hall in Los Angeles, California.
Ali Larter attracted attention with her hot, form-fitting, strapless burgundy dress with a sweetheart neckline, corset-style boning on the body, and a draped waist that was gathered and tied all the way to the floor.

Larter, who was nominated along with her “Landman” co-stars in the category of outstanding performance by an ensemble in a drama series, wore a chunky silver metallic choker necklace and stacked silver cuff bracelets. She wore her hair up in a middle part and her makeup included a dark red lip that matched her dress.

Kate Hudson, who earned a best actress nomination for her role in “Song Sung Blue,” wowed in a champagne-toned dress with a bandeau bodice that exposed part of her midriff.
The dress featured a flowing waist, smock in the middle, and dramatic cape sleeves that reached from the shoulders to the floor, creating a long train.

Gwyneth Paltrow dazzled in a sleeveless black Givenchy gown that featured a sheer bodice with a deep V-neck and a lace overlay as well as an embellished tea-length tulle skirt. Paltrow accessorized with turquoise drop earrings and sported black strappy sandals. The Goop founder wore her hair into a sleek bun and wore natural makeup.

Kristen Bell, who hosted the awards, dared to go bare in a nude, champagne-toned gown by Georges Hobeika Couture, adorned with cascading silver beading, a deep V-neck, gray satin paneling wrapped around her waist, and a dramatic pleated overskirt.
The “Veronica Mars” star accessorised with a diamond necklace featuring teardrop-shaped stones, matching drop earrings and diamond rings. Bell styled her hair in side-parted waves and opted for natural, bright makeup.
